In a pea plant, yellow seeds are dominant and green seeds are recessive. a pea plant that is homozygous dominant for seed color is crossed with a pea plant that is heterozygous. what percentage of the offspring from this cross would be heterozygous?

1 Answer

6 votes
The percentage that the offspring will be heterozygous is 50%.
